Abstract

Official abstract text for this publication.

A concentrated bioenzymatic cleaning product is provided which maintains a homogenous composition under static conditions and does not require shaking or mixing prior to dilution. The concentrated bioenzymatic cleaning product includes bacillus spores, a suspending and/or rheology modifying agent, an odor control agent, a pH adjuster, and water. The types and amounts of ingredients are selected to maintain the bacillus spores in suspension under static conditions, enabling the concentrated bioenzymatic cleaning product to be diluted using a proportioner system.

First claim

Opening claim text (preview).

We claim: 1. A bioenzymatic, concentrated cleaning product, consisting essentially of: bacillus spores, having an average diameter of 5-50 microns and selected from the group consisting of extracellular protease enzymes, extracellular urease enzymes, extracellular amylase enzymes, extracellular lypase enzymes, extracellular cellulase enzymes, and combinations thereof; a suspending and/or rheology modifying agent; an odor control agent; sufficient pH adjuster to maintain a pH of 7.0 to about 9.5; optional wetting agents and dispersing agents; and a balance of water; wherein the bacillus spores are present at 15% to 55% by weight and are able to remain suspended in the water for two years under static conditions. 2.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the suspending and/or rheology modifying agent is selected from the group consisting of xanthan gum, guar gum, acrylate copolymers, celluloses, smectic clays, and combinations thereof. 3.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the suspending agent comprises xanthan gum. 4.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the suspending and/or rheology modifying agent is present at about 0.1-2% by weight. 5.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the odor control agent is selected from the group consisting of fragrances, malodor control agents, and combinations thereof. 6.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the odor control agent is present at about 0.1-2% by weight. 7.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the pH adjuster is selected from the group consisting of organic acids, mineral acids, and combinations thereof. 8.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the pH adjuster comprises lactic acid. 9. The bioenzymatic, concentrated cleaning product of claim 1 , wherein the water is present in an amount of at least about 45% by weight. 10. A bioenzymatic, concentrated cleaning product, consisting essentially of: 35% to 55% by weight bacillus spores having an average particle diameter of 5-50 microns; about 0.1-2% by weight of a suspending and/or rheology modifying agent; about 0.1-2% by weight of an odor control agent; an acidic pH adjuster optional wetting agents and dispersing agents; and a balance of water; wherein the bacillus spores are able to remain suspended in the water for two years under static conditions. 11. The bioenzymatic, concentrated cleaning product of claim 10 , wherein the suspending agent comprises a gum. 12. The bioenzymatic, concentrated cleaning product of claim 10 , wherein the odor control agent produces a citrus odor. 13. The bioenzymatic, concentrated cleaning product of claim 10 , wherein the pH adjuster comprises sufficient acid to maintain a pH of about 5.0-9.5. 14. The bioenzymatic, concentrated cleaning product of claim 10 , wherein the pH adjuster comprises sufficient acid to maintain a pH of about 6.0-8.0. 15. The bioenzymatic, concentrated cleaning product of claim 10 , wherein the water is present in an amount of at least about 45% by weight. 16. A method of preparing a bioenzymatic cleaning product from a concentrate, consisting of the steps of: mixing 15% to 55% by weight bacillus spores having an average particle diameter of 5-50 microns with a suspending and/or rheology modifying agent, an odor control agent, sufficient pH adjuster to maintain a pH of about 5.0-9.5, optional wetting agents and dispersing agents, and a balance of water, to form a concentrate; and diluting the concentrate with water using a proportioner system, to yield the bioenzymatic cleaning product. 17. A bioenzymatic concentrated cleaning product from a concentrate, consisting essentially of: bacillus spores having an average particle diameter of 5-50 microns and selected from the group consisting of extracellular protease enzymes, extracellular urease enzymes, extracellular amylase enzymes, extracellular lipase enzymes, extracellular cellulose enzymes, and combinations thereof; a suspending and/or rheology modifying agent; an odor control agent: sufficient pH adjuster to maintain a pH of about 5.0 to about 9.5; optional wetting agents and dispersing agents; and a balance of water; wherein the bacillus spores are present at 35% to 55% b weight and are able to remain suspended in the water for two years under static conditions. 18. A bioenzymatic concentrated cleaning product, consisting of: bacillus spores having an average particle diameter of 5-50 microns and selected from the group consisting of extracellular protease enzymes, extracellular urease enzymes, extracellular amylase enzymes, extracellular lipase enzymes, extracellular cellulose enzymes, and combinations thereof; a suspending and/or rheology modifying agent; an odor control agent: sufficient pH adjuster to maintain a pH of about 5.0 to about 9.5; optional wetting agents and dispersing agents; and a balance of water.
